As a Senior SDET in the Digital Airport Customer Experience team, you will engineer the quality of Delta’s customer-facing digital channels for Checkin. You will work across API, microservices, DevOps pipelines, and AI‑assisted engineering tools to ensure world-class reliability and customer experience.

This is a senior individual-contributor role with strong hands-on ownership and no people-management responsibilities.

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, and maintain automated tests across API, and backend microservices.
  • Enhance and evolve modern, scalable automation frameworks.
  • Collaborate closely with UI, engineering, UX, product, and architecture teams to embed quality from design to deployment.
  • Review code and contribute to technical discussions emphasizing testability and reliability.
  • Build reusable utilities, libraries, and internal tooling to improve automation efficiency.
  • Debug and troubleshoot issues across distributed systems and cloud environments.
  • Integrate automated tests into CI/CD pipelines with strong quality gates.
  • Leverage AI-assisted development tools such as GitHub Copilot and Amazon Q to:
    • Generate test cases and automation scaffolding
    • Expand coverage for edge cases and negative scenarios
    • Refactor automation code
    • Enhance documentation and readability
  • Apply Prompt Engineering to craft precise, structured prompts that improve test generation, debugging workflows, and test data creation.
  • Use AI-driven log analysis, anomaly detection, and visual validation capabilities to identify defects early.
  • Create reusable prompt templates for consistent, scalable AI-driven test workflows.
  • Actively contribute in Agile ceremonies and promote engineering excellence within the team.
